text: The Harley-Davidson Freewheeler is a motorized tricycle introduced by Harley-Davidson in August, 2014 for the 2015 model year. It is designated the FLRT. It has a 1,690 cc displacement, air-cooled, V-twin engine with 142 N⋅m (105 lbf⋅ft) torque and a six-speed transmission with reverse. The model is distinguished from the other Harley three-wheeler, the Tri Glide Ultra Classic, by having mini ape hanger handlebars and bobtail fenders for a low profile.
